#95ef73 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#95ef73 is composed of 58.4% red, 93.7%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.9%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 103.5 degrees, a saturation of 79.5% and a lightness of 69.4%. #95ef73 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e6 with #2bdf00. Closest websafe color is: #99ff66.

Shades and Tints of #95ef73

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f2fdee is the lightest one.
